4. Salary & Benefits
Hotel job salaries in UAE vary by role, experience, and hotel category. Monthly salaries typically range from 1500 AED for housekeeping and support staff to 7000 AED or more for management and specialized positions. Many hotels also provide accommodation, transport allowance, health insurance, and performance-based incentives.
| Role | Monthly Salary (AED) | Additional Benefits |
|---|---|---|
| Housekeeping Staff | 1500–2500 | Accommodation, Transport |
| Front Desk / Receptionist | 2500–4000 | Accommodation, Tips |
| Waiter / Waitress | 1800–3000 | Tips, Meal Allowance |
| Kitchen Helper / Chef | 2000–4500 | Accommodation, Training |
| Hotel Security | 2000–3500 | Transport, Insurance |
| Managerial Roles | 5000–7000+ | Accommodation, Bonus |

6. Working Hours & Schedule
Hotel staff typically work in shifts, ensuring 24/7 service. Shifts may include morning, evening, or night schedules. Full-time roles usually consist of 8–10 hours per day, while part-time or temporary roles may vary depending on demand. Some roles, especially in food and housekeeping, may offer overtime pay during peak periods.
